Teru Malleshwara Temple, Hiriyur

A Dravidian Vijayanagara-era Shiva temple on the bank of the Vedavathi at Hiriyur, known for its ornate wooden temple car (teru) and its annual car festival — the heritage anchor of the town. One more place around Hiriyur worth a day of its own.

damVani Vilasa Sagara (Mari Kanive Dam)

25.6 km · 31 min drive

Karnataka’s oldest continuously operating dam, built by the Mysore Wodeyars across the Vedavathi (Hagari) river in 1907 and set in a gorge between hills, with terraced theme gardens, a rare Krishna Ficus tree and long reservoir views — on the Hiriyur–Hosadurga border.
